In April, the number of property sales agreed per estate
agency branch increased to the highest level seen since October, according to
the latest data from the NAEA. The number of sales agreed per member branch
increased for the first time this year, rising from an average of seven per
branch in March, to eight in April. This is the highest level seen since
October 2018, when the same number of sales were recorded per branch. However,
year-on-year, the number of property transactions remains the same. Read more
